Output e1afb3c26f63db5dc4a53de2317886806e51cefde11433bc36da19a9ea999afa:6

value
1156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9aab066a61ac326f4e400b32d5f1374e8fd6bab069f21e5bec65ab79de5b8503
address
bc1pn24sv6np4sex7njqpvedtufhf68adw4sd8epuklvvk4hnhjms5ps0xpszc
transaction
e1afb3c26f63db5dc4a53de2317886806e51cefde11433bc36da19a9ea999afa
spent
true